In my series "VIEW OF THE WORLD" I deal with the beauty and destruction of our planet, but from a perspective that often goes unnoticed - from a distance, as if looking at the earth from space. My abstract paintings show seas, coastlines, islands, and river courses that have been created by the geological processes of our earth. 


The view from a distance changes the perception of what we see. Details that are still noticeable in everyday life - such as the destruction and pollution caused by humans - disappear or are lost in the overall picture. A new image emerges that has a completely different meaning. It shows the Earth not only as a habitat, but also as a dynamic, ever-changing organism influenced by natural and human forces. The image of the world thus becomes a reflection on the relationship between beauty and destruction, order and chaos. Through alienation, the earth becomes a metaphorical space that shows us both its beauty and its fragility. Abstraction serves me as a means of sharpening the gaze - taking the viewer beyond the familiar and enabling a deeper, more reflective engagement with the world and human responsibility.
